Memorial concert in honor of the late Dr. Charles Callahan

Did you know that St. Joe’s has one of the finest organs in the Archdiocese? A large part of that owes to the diligent work of Charles Callahan on the organ’s renovation. Callahan was an award-winning composer, organist, and choir director with over 300 works for organ, piano, chorus, and orchestra. In 1991, he was awarded the Papal Honor of Knighthood in the Order of the Holy Sepulchre of Jerusalem. Callahan died on Christmas Day of 2023. The memorial concert on May 3rd will feature organists Leo Abbott, Fred MacArthur, Wesley Parrott, as well as Ellen Hinkle (flute) and Danny Philipps (bassoon).
